Job Title: Financial Controller Start Date: 2026-08-03 - 2026-09-03 Vacancy Type: Permanent JHB003373 Sectors: Accounts Location: Gauteng , Tshwane (Pretoria) Salary: (Market related) Brief: The Financial Controller is responsible for managing the company's financial operations, ensuring accurate financial reporting, maintaining strong internal controls, overseeing budgeting and forecasting, managing cash flow, and ensuring compliance with South African financial and tax legislation. Within a meat processing environment, the role also focuses heavily on production costing, inventory management, yield analysis, and profitability across the processing operation. Key Duties and Responsibilities Financial Management Prepare mon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ements. Manage the month-end and year-end closing processes. Ensure accurate general ledger reconciliations. Produce management accounts and financial reports. Analyse financial performance and provide recommendations to management. Monitor company profitability and financial health. Cost Accounting & Production Costing Calculate production costs and cost of sales. Monitor processing costs, labour costs, overhead allocations, and factory efficiencies. Analyse carcass yields, production variances, and waste. Develop and maintain standard costing models. Review product margins and profitability. Identify cost-saving opportunities throughout production. Inventory Control Monitor raw material, packaging, work-in-progress, and finished goods inventory. Ensure accurate stock valuations. Investigate stock variances and losses. Work closely with warehouse and production teams. Assist with regular stock counts and audits. Ensure FIFO principles are correctly applied where appropriate. Budgeting & Forecasting Prepare annual budgets. Develop financial forecasts. Monitor departmental expenditure. Analyse budget variances. Provide recommendations to improve financial performance. Cash Flow Management Monitor daily cash flow. Manage working capital. Forecast cash requirements. Assist with banking relationships. Ensure supplier payments are managed efficiently. Financial Reporting Prepare monthly management reports. Produce KPI dashboards. Report on: Gross Profit Operating Profit Factory efficiency Production costs Inventory levels Labour costs Waste percentages Yield analysis Sales margins Compliance Ensure compliance with: IFRS (where applicable) South African tax legislation VAT regulations PAYE SARS requirements Companies Act Coordinate external audits. Prepare audit schedules. Maintain internal financial controls. Payroll Oversight Review payroll journals. Ensure payroll reconciliations are accurate. Monitor labour cost percentages. Ensure statutory deductions are correctly processed. Team Management Supervise finance staff. Train and mentor finance personnel. Allocate workloads. Conduct performance reviews. Develop finance department procedures. Business Analysis Analyse profitability by: Product Customer Department Processing line Prepare financial models for management decisions. Support pricing strategies. Evaluate capital expenditure proposals. Internal Controls Maintain strong financial controls. Improve financial processes. Reduce financial risk. Monitor fraud prevention measures. Ensure segregation of duties. Detail: Minimum Qualifications Bachelor's Degree in Accounting, Finance, or Financial Management. Completed SAICA or SAIPA articles is advantageous. Professional qualification such as CA(SA), CIMA, or ACCA is highly advantageous. Experience Required 5–8 years' experience in a financial management or financial controller role. Experience within: Meat processing Food manufacturing FMCG Manufacturing Agricultural processing Strong experience in production costing and inventory management. Experience working with ERP systems. Experience managing finance teams. Technical Skills Advanced Microsoft Excel. ERP systems (e.g. SAP, Syspro, Sage X3, Microsoft Dynamics 365, or similar). Cost accounting. Financial modelling. Budgeting and forecasting. Inventory costing. Management reporting. Financial analysis. VAT and tax compliance. Strong knowledge of IFRS and South African accounting standards. show more...
